Transaction c3868eb63b439508719c3a85ec2e0160cb88be07aa7890338dad7fd96300a307

2 Input
1 Outputs
  • c3868eb63b439508719c3a85ec2e0160cb88be07aa7890338dad7fd96300a307:0
  • value  5489223
    address  1ExTWnYd4cqt3dFDUQtUMcsqqh6w2GhScr